I've been having a bunch of issues with my PC lately. The newest problem happened today.

I got a new SSD and installed it. When I plugged the computer back in after installing it turned on automatically (I never hit the power button). Then after a couple of seconds it turned off. If I press the power button after that nothing happens.

The computer is about 7 years old now and the PSU is about 3 years old.

I've been having other issues with it as well recently. In December I bought a new HDD and after installing the PC wouldn't boot. I reseated the GPU and RAM and that seemed to fix it. Then last month I re-applied thermal paste and after it would boot but with no video output. I reseated the RAM, CPU, and GPU and that seemed to fix the problem.

Things I've tried:
- Re-seating RAM and GPU
- I've checked the cables
- I've tried to boot without the new SSD plugged

Specs:
- AMD Phenom II X4 955
- Radeon 4580 HD
- ASUS M3A78-CM
- 550W Cooler Master PSU
- 8GB RAM
- NZXT Apollo Case
 
Solution
I'll just reply in case anyone else has this problem. I removed the GPU, RAM, HDDs, and unplugged everything and then put everything back and it is now working. It must have been some short or something not quite seated fully.
